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/asp.net/36.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Database 文本文件(.txt)作为数据库:最佳实践_Database_Text Files - Fatal编程技术网

Database 文本文件(.txt)作为数据库:最佳实践

Database 文本文件(.txt)作为数据库:最佳实践,database,text-files,Database,Text Files,我想使用txt文件作为数据库。对于想使用txt文件作为数据库的人,有什么建议吗,比如最佳实践列表?例如: 我应该只使用单行文件,避免回车等吗 文件应该是ASCII、ANSI、UNICODE,还是任何一个好的文件 我是否应该保持文件干净,不受可能损坏数据的特定ASCII、ANSI、UNICODE字符集(等)的影响 我应该使用CSV、TSV或TXT还是其他人都好 等等 求求你,任何帮助都将不胜感激。对我来说,txt文件似乎是一个完美的解决方案,但可能是我目前看不到的,可能会给我带来麻烦。不要。当

我想使用txt文件作为数据库。对于想使用txt文件作为数据库的人,有什么建议吗,比如最佳实践列表?例如:

  • 我应该只使用单行文件,避免回车等吗
  • 文件应该是ASCII、ANSI、UNICODE,还是任何一个好的文件
  • 我是否应该保持文件干净,不受可能损坏数据的特定ASCII、ANSI、UNICODE字符集(等)的影响
  • 我应该使用CSV、TSV或TXT还是其他人都好
  • 等等

求求你,任何帮助都将不胜感激。对我来说,txt文件似乎是一个完美的解决方案,但可能是我目前看不到的,可能会给我带来麻烦。

不要。当你不能依赖数据库连接或类似的东西时,让你的生活变得简单,试试XML或Json:)SQLite呢?我想SQLite是二进制的。我将坚持使用XML或Json,以避免将来可能出现的(某些?)麻烦:)文本文件(包括XML和Json)是“文档”。数据库通常被认为是不同的东西。您是否打算为您的数据使用某种数据库库?如果是这样的话,它是否有一个你正在考虑的格式的“驱动程序”?我想(需要)创建一个简单的数据库“系统”,用于存储字符串之类的数据,这些数据可以通过Word VBA、Excel VBA、Python和AutoIT轻松访问。